US DOE progress report says 1M plug-ins by 2015 ambitious but achievable; not likely to be constrained by production capacity

The US Department of Energy (DOE) has released One Million Electric Vehicles by 2015 , a short status report on advances in deployment and progress to date in meeting President Obama’s goal of putting one million plug-in electric vehicles (PEV) on the road by 2015.
